I get the impression from watching the developers list that the
Netwinder gets a bit too hot when on it's side. It needs to be
vertical for ther chimney convection effect to cool it down.

This would probably make it a bit difficult to use as a wearable,
because you'd probably want to stowe it in a bag, and not worry too
much about it's facing.

Of course that also makes it a bit lame for rack mounting, but that
isn't a wearable issue is it?
